Trump Administration To Make Major Announcement On Autism On Monday

US President Donald Trump said his administration will make a major announcement related to autism. A sharp rise has been seen in Autism diagnosis in the US since 2000.

US President Donald Trump said his administration will make a major announcement regarding autism on Monday. While Trump did not provide details, he suggested that the issue is urgent and deeply concerning, citing what he described as a dramatic rise in autism rates among children.

“We’re going to have an announcement on autism on Monday. It’s got to be Monday. Because what’s happened with autism,” he said during a public appearance.

“I think it’s gonna be a very important announcement. I think its gonna be one of the most important things that we will do,” he added.

He further compared autism prevalence over time, claiming, “If you go back 15 years, maybe a little bit longer, it was one in 10,000 children who had autism? Now it’s 1 in 12 boys. Think of it.”

The US President did not elaborate on the nature of the upcoming announcement—whether it would be related to policy, funding, healthcare, or research.

This comes following a Wall Street Journal report earlier this month that suggested officials would release information linking Tylenol to the condition in children, the Hill reported.

In the past, Trump, Urban Development Secretary Ben Carson and Health and Human Services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r. publicly made statements linking autism to vaccines and other medicines despite a lack of research to support their claims, the outlet claimed.

Autism diagnoses in the US have seen a sharp rise since 2000, fueling growing public concern. According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), the autism rate among 8-year-old children reached 1 in 36 (or 2.77%) by 2020. This marks a steady increase from 2.27% in 2018 and just 0.66% in 2000, highlighting a significant upward trend over two decades.
